WebAug 11, 2024 · A clinical trial of a gene therapy for a rare neurological disease is on hold after a participant in the study developed a bone marrow disorder that can lead to leukemia, the trial’s sponsor, bluebird bio, announced Monday.The company said the cancer was likely caused by the virus that ferries a therapeutic gene into patients’ stem cells.
